PHILOSOPHY

Antonia provides individual counseling to children, adolescents, and adults utilizing therapeutic techniques from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, Person-Centered Therapy, Strengths-Based Therapy, and mindfulness-based interventions. Antonia provides an easygoing, friendly, and enlightening environment for clients to work through their mental health needs. She strives to assist clients with feeling comfortable in the office. BIO

Antonia completed her undergraduate studies at Clarke University in 2020 and received her Bachelor of Social Work and Bachelor of Arts in Psychology. Following completion of her bachelor's degrees, she completed her graduate study at Clarke University in 2021 and received her Master of Social Work degree. Antonia is a Licensed Master of Social Work (LMSW) in the State of Iowa. Antonia has been practicing therapy services in the community since 2021.
